Our markets
What draws us to each state.
Illinois
Illinois has one of the most established community solar programs in the country. The state's programs have created a substantial subscriber base and a well-defined interconnection process. We know the market deeply.
Iowa
Iowa's rural agricultural character is well-suited to community solar. The state has strong grid infrastructure from decades of wind development, and landowners here are experienced partners in long-term energy agreements.
Missouri
Missouri's community solar market is expanding, with utility programs opening new development opportunities. Agricultural land in the state is productive, and we've built relationships with landowners across multiple counties.
New York
New York's NY-Sun program and interconnection framework make it one of the most active community solar markets in the country. We work primarily in rural upstate territories where agricultural land is available and interconnection is accessible.
